The State Street IG Public & Private ABS ETF (the "Fund") seeks to maximize risk-adjusted returns and provide current income. The fund invests in a portfolio of investment grade asset-backed securities ("ABS"), including a combination of (i) public ABS and (ii) private ABS including, but not limited to, those sourced by Apollo Global Securities, LLC ("Apollo"). Investment-grade ABS are instruments that are rated at the time of purchase BBB- or higher. The Fund intends to invest in ABS of any kind. The Fund intends to invest in private ABS, which refers to a wide range of credit instruments, such as instruments that are directly originated, issued in private offerings, issued to private companies, and/or issued to borrowers by non-bank lenders (i.e., non-bank lending instruments), including, but not limited to, private ABS sourced by Apollo (each such instrument, an "AOS Investment"). The Adviser actively-manages the Fund using a risk-aware, top-down approach combined with bottom-up security selection to construct a portfolio that seeks to overweight the most attractive sectors and issuers.
